I don't think anyone in the top-5 would trade down for that package, which is basically what you have to do because Philly is 100% taking Desnoyers at 6 if he lasts to that spot.

I think the top-10 is looking something like:

1. NYI: Schaefer
2. San Jose: Misa
3. Chicago: Frondell
4. Utah: Martone
5. Nashville: Hagens
6. Philly: Desnoyers
7. Boston: O'Brien
8. Seattle: Martin
9. Buffalo: Mrtka
10. Anaheim: McQueen

So to get Desnoyers, you need to trade up to #5 or higher and I don't really see anyone in the top-5 moving down for that.

Yeah I think this is more of the issue than anything. Philly has like 7 picks in the top-45 this year, why would they trade down from 6 to get 2 more?

In the top-6, I don't think any of the top-3 trade down for that value, while Utah and Philly don't need more picks. That leaves Nashville at #5, but if Hagens slips to #5, I don't think there's any chance that they pass on him. I don't think Desnoyers lasts beyond pick #6.
